Southern Xinjiang is famous for its unique history, culture, and diverse agricultural civilization, with the perfect combination of desert and Gobi. It is delightful to adventure to southern Xinjiang, you will be amazed by its ancient Islamic architecture and unique customs, Kashgar is a city in the Tarim Basin region of southern Xinjiang, and one of the westernmost cities of China, located near the country’s border with Kyrgyzstan and Tajikistan. For over 2,000 years, Kashgar was a strategically important oasis on the Silk Road between China, the Middle East, and Europe.
Northern Xinjiang is a haven for travelers who appreciate natural beauty and photography. Kanas National Park, nestled amidst mountains and lakes, is often referred to as “Oriental Switzerland”. Yili region is known for its valleys nestled in mountains, adorned with beautiful grasslands and lush forests. The region is home to three renowned grasslands: Narat, Kalajun, and Bayinbuluk.
